Pulleeeeze. Otis was the shizit.
He was just about to crossover in a HUGE way. Dock Of The Bay My favorite tune though is Try A Little Tenderness. Others: These Arms Of Mine That's How Strong My Love Is I've Been Loving You Too Long Shake Respect Cigarettes And Coffee Fa-Fa-Fa-Fa-Fa Hard To Handle I've Got Dreams To Remember Even his Beatles and Stones covers were cool...different but cool. Day Tripper A Hard Day's Night Satisfaction Another artist that was lost too soon. tA Tribal Disorder
